64 /*
65  * Passthrough ioctl commands. These are passed through to devices
66  * as they are, it is expected that the device (a module, for example),
67  * will know how to deal with them. One for each emulation, so that
68  * no namespace clashes will occur between them, for devices that
69  * may be dealing with specific ioctls for multiple emulations.
70  */
71 
72 struct ioctl_pt {
73 	unsigned long com;
74 	void *data;
75 };
76 
77 #define PTIOCNETBSD	_IOW('Z', 0, struct ioctl_pt)
78 #define PTIOCSUNOS	_IOW('Z', 1, struct ioctl_pt)
79 #define PTIOCSVR4	_IOW('Z', 2, struct ioctl_pt)
80 #define PTIOCLINUX	_IOW('Z', 3, struct ioctl_pt)
81 #define PTIOCFREEBSD	_IOW('Z', 4, struct ioctl_pt)
82 #define PTIOCOSF1	_IOW('Z', 5, struct ioctl_pt)
83 #define PTIOCULTRIX	_IOW('Z', 6, struct ioctl_pt)
84 #define PTIOCWIN32	_IOW('Z', 7, struct ioctl_pt)
